Mustafi posts promising injury update!

Arsenal have begun to drop off yet again in the Premier League following on from a disastrous week of football. A 2-1 defeat to Everton in midweek, followed by a loss against Manchester City by the same score line means that the Gunners are now nine points behind table leaders Chelsea. It means that Arsenal are once again in danger of dropping out of contention for the league title before Christmas.

One of the big factors of our decline in form during November and December, has been the poor form in defence. The Gunners defence has been an absolute shambles in recent weeks and it reminds you of a time six or seven years ago when you feared every opposition attack posing a real danger to our defenders. Now the defence we currently have holds far more quality than the defenders from previous seasons, but it is a real concern to see that Arsenal haven’t kept a Premier League clean sheet since our 0-0 draw with Middlesborough. It’s a run of eight Premier League games without a clean sheet and something the Gunners must improve on ahead of a busy schedule.

Arsenal made major steps towards making the defence stronger during the summer, with defence additions in Rob Holding and Shkodran Mustafi. It’s the latter player who has become a regular centre back to partner Laurent Koscielny, however currently the German international is ruled out with an injury.

Mustafi picked up a hamstring problem in our 3-1 win over Stoke at the Emirates and has subsequently been replaced by backup defender Gabriel. However in my opinion the Brazilian hasn’t impressed at all at centre back, instead he’s just adding to the calamity that already seems to be amongst the current defence strategies. As a result we cannot wait for Mustafi to get back into the line up and today he has revealed some good news for us.

Mustafi revealed to Arsenal fans today that he’s already back at the gym working on his fitness. The German said: “Nothing worth having comes easy. So let’s put in some extra hours at the gym.”

It was anticipated that Mustafi would miss the entire of the busy christmas period with his hamstring problem, however a quick return to gym work and soon training, may mean that the defender will be back on the pitch ahead of schedule. A return date was initially set for the New Year, but if Mustafi is ready to be back on the pitch for our fixtures against Crystal Palace or Bournemouth then it will definitely be a big boost for the Gunners.
